返回
Rollup:快速构建JavaScript项目
前端
2024-02-04 12:19:07
好用又小巧!Rollup教程助你快速入门!
前言
Rollup是一款现代化的JavaScript打包工具,它以其出色的构建速度和体积优化而闻名。如果您正在寻找一种快速、可靠且易于使用的工具来构建您的JavaScript项目,那么Rollup绝对是您的不二之选。
1. 安装和配置
首先,您需要在您的项目中安装Rollup。您可以使用以下命令通过npm安装Rollup:
npm install --save-dev rollup
安装完成后,您可以在您的项目中创建一个名为“rollup.config.js”的文件。这个文件将包含Rollup的配置信息。
// rollup.config.js
export default {
input: 'src/index.js',
output: {
file: 'dist/bundle.js',
format: 'umd',
},
};
在上面的配置中,我们指定了要打包的文件(input)和打包后的输出文件(output)。我们还指定了输出文件的格式(format),在本例中,我们使用的是UMD格式。
2. 使用Rollup构建项目
现在,您可以使用Rollup构建您的项目了。您可以使用以下命令来构建您的项目:
rollup -c rollup.config.js
如果您在构建过程中遇到了问题,您可以使用以下命令来查看错误信息:
rollup -c rollup.config.js --silent
3. Rollup的特性
Rollup具有许多强大的特性,包括:
- 模块化: Rollup支持模块化开发,您可以将您的代码分成多个模块,然后使用Rollup将这些模块打包成一个文件。
- Tree shaking: Rollup可以自动删除未使用的代码,从而减小打包后的文件体积。
- 代码分割: Rollup可以将您的代码分割成多个文件,从而提高页面的加载速度。
4. 结语
Rollup是一款功能强大且易于使用的JavaScript打包工具。如果您正在寻找一种快速、可靠且易于使用的工具来构建您的JavaScript项目,那么Rollup绝对是您的不二之选。